If your car is in good condition, IE. no dents, scraches or damage of any kind, it is the easiest. If you do have any damage they will have to fix all the damage first then they can continue with the painting. Any shop will just take apart the car, scuff the doorjams, under trunk, under the hood and any other hard to reach parts. Then they will paint all those parts, install them back on the car, and then paint the entire car at one time. I have my car at the Waynesville Career Center getting painted right now. I have them installing my entire body kit and painting it at the same time. As you can see in my profile my car was black and now it is going to be Grabber Blue. If you go to some huge shop it will cost you 3 to $4,000 just to paint it. The trade school is only charging me $1,000 for the whole thing(installing body kit, changing the paint color and using their paint.) If you can find someone who owns a small paint shop it will also cost you less then the big shops, just make sure you check their output for quality. But the best route I think is to use a Trade School around your area, it will take longer due to they have to work durring school hours only, but they can't put out anything that is bad quality.

1 1/2 gallons will paint a car inside and out. When I purchased this paint I made sure that I got enought just incase i get anything different for the car; IE. roadster covers, different side scoops or damage something that can be replaced, that way I can match it exactly.
